Womala Car Suspension Parts Tie Rod Ball Head Front Stabilizer Bar Control Arm Assembly for Mercedes-Benz
Source:Customer Case /
Time:2025-08-19
Womala Car Suspension Parts Tie Rod Ball Head Front Stabilizer Bar Control Arm Assembly for Mercedes-Benz




